/** * Open an appropriate destination browser so that the user can specify a source * to import from */ protected void handleDescriptionFileBrowseButtonPressed() { S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arOptionsP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arOptionsP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getDescriptionLocation())); if (dialog.open() == Window.OK) { IPath path= dialog.getResult(); path= path.removeFileExtension().addFileExtension(JarPackagerUtil.DESCRIPTION_EXTENSION); fDescriptionFileText.setText(path.toString()); } }
/** * Open an appropriate destination browser so that the user can specify a source * to import from */ protected void handleDescriptionFileBrowseButtonPressed() { S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arOptionsP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arOptionsP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getDescriptionLocation())); if (dialog.open() == Window.OK) { IPath path= dialog.getResult(); path= path.removeFileExtension().addFileExtension(AJJarPackagerUtil.DESCRIPTION_EXTENSION); fDescriptionFileText.setText(path.toString()); } }
/** * Open an appropriate destination browser so that the user can specify a source * to import from */ protected void handleDescriptionFileBrowseButtonPressed() { S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arOptionsP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arOptionsP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getDescriptionLocation())); if (dialog.open() == Window.OK) { IPath path= dialog.getResult(); path= path.removeFileExtension().addFileExtension(JarPackagerUtil.DESCRIPTION_EXTENSION); fDescriptionFileText.setText(path.toString()); } }
/** * Open an appropriate dialog so that the user can specify a manifest * to save */ protected void handleNewManifestFileBrowseButtonPressed() { // Use Save As dialog to select a new file inside the workspace S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arManifestWizardP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arManifestWizardP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getManifestLocation())); if (dialog.open() == Window.OK) { fJarPackage.setManifestLocation(dialog.getResult()); fNewManifestFileText.setText(dialog.getResult().toString()); } }
/** * Open an appropriate destination browser so that the user can specify a source * to import from */ protected void handleDescriptionFileBrowseButtonPressed() { S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arOptionsP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arOptionsP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getDescriptionLocation())); if (dialog.open() == Window.OK) { IPath path= dialog.getResult(); path= path.removeFileExtension().addFileExtension(JarPackagerUtil.DESCRIPTION_EXTENSION); fDescriptionFileText.setText(path.toString()); } }
/** * Open an appropriate dialog so that the user can specify a manifest * to save */ protected void handleNewManifestFileBrowseButtonPressed() { // Use Save As dialog to select a new file inside the workspace S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arManifestWizardP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arManifestWizardP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getManifestLocation())); if (dialog.open() == Window.OK) { fJarPackage.setManifestLocation(dialog.getResult()); fNewManifestFileText.setText(dialog.getResult().toString()); } }
/** * Open an appropriate dialog so that the user can specify a manifest * to save */ protected void handleNewManifestFileBrowseButtonPressed() { // Use Save As dialog to select a new file inside the workspace S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arManifestWizardP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arManifestWizardP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getManifestLocation())); if (dialog.open() == Window.OK) { fJarPackage.setManifestLocation(dialog.getResult()); fNewManifestFileText.setText(dialog.getResult().toString()); } }
/** * Open an appropriate dialog so that the user can specify a manifest * to save */ protected void handleNewManifestFileBrowseButtonPressed() { // Use Save As dialog to select a new file inside the workspace S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arManifestWizardP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arManifestWizardP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getManifestLocation())); if (dialog.open() == Window.OK) { fJarPackage.setManifestLocation(dialog.getResult()); fNewManifestFileText.setText(dialog.getResult().toString()); } }
/** * Open an appropriate destination browser so that the user can specify a source * to import from */ protected void handleDescriptionFileBrowseButtonPressed() { SaveAsDialog dialog= new SaveAsDialog(getContainer().getShell()); dialog.create(); dialog.getShell().setText(JarPackagerMessages.JarPackageWizardPage_saveAsDialog_title); dialog.setMessage(JarPackagerMessages.JarPackageWizardPage_saveAsDialog_message); dialog.setOriginalFile(createFileHandle(fJarPackage.getDescriptionLocation())); if (dialog.open() == Window.OK) { IPath path= dialog.getResult(); path= path.removeFileExtension().addFileExtension(AJJarPackagerUtil.DESCRIPTION_EXTENSION); fDescriptionFileText.setText(path.toString()); } }
dialog.setOriginalFile(originalFile); dialog.create();
public void doSaveAs(IProgressMonitor monitor) throws Exception { // Get the editor shell Shell shell = getEditor().getSite().getShell(); // Create the save as dialog SaveAsDialog dialog = new SaveAsDialog(shell); // Set the initial file name to the original file name IFile file = null; if (fEditorInput instanceof IFileEditorInput) { file = ((IFileEditorInput) fEditorInput).getFile(); dialog.setOriginalFile(file); } // Create the dialog dialog.create(); // Warn the user if the underlying file does not exist if (fDocumentProvider.isDeleted(fEditorInput) && (file != null)) { String message = NLS.bind(PDEUIMessages.InputContext_errorMessageFileDoesNotExist, file.getName()); dialog.setErrorMessage(null); dialog.setMessage(message, IMessageProvider.WARNING); } // Open the dialog if (dialog.open() == Window.OK) { // Get the path to where the new file will be stored IPath path = dialog.getResult(); handleSaveAs(monitor, path); } }
dialog.create(); dialog.setMessage(PDEUIMessages.TargetEditor_0, IMessageProvider.NONE); if (target.getHandle() instanceof WorkspaceFileTargetHandle) {
dialog.setOriginalFile(original); dialog.create();
dialog.setOriginalFile(original); dialog.create();
dialog.setOriginalName(input.getName()); dialog.create();